Adjective: Mandean  man'dee-un
  1. Of or relating to the Mandaean people or their language or culture
    "Mandean religious texts are written in classical Mandaic";
    - Mandaean
Noun: Mandean  man'dee-un
  1. A member of a small Gnostic sect that originated in Jordan and survives in Iraq and who believes that John the Baptist was the Messiah
    - Mandaean
     
  2. The form of Aramaic used by the Mandeans
    - Mandaean, Mandaean language, Mandean language

Derived forms: Mandeans

Type of: Aramaic, Aramaic language, religious person
